
MARRIAGE
Don't Touch That Thermostat!
Our temperature differences were amusing
at first.
by Deborah Draper
from Marriage Partnership
It was right after our honeymoon, when we set up house, that we revealed our true colors. Denny is rednot just the color of his beloved Nebraska Huskers football team, but also of molten lava, stove burners, and cinnamon candy. His body temperature runs hot at all times.
Like the Lions of my Detroit hometown, my color is blue, reminiscent of icicles, cold water, and peppermint gum. Although red and blue aren't precisely opposite each other on the color wheel, they're far enough apart to make problematic decisions regarding the perfect indoor temperature. More
